Font Size: a A A

Application Research Of Mouse Gestures Recognition Based On Intelligent Algorithm

Posted on:2014-01-30Degree:MasterType:Thesis
Country:ChinaCandidate:G ChengFull Text:PDF
GTID:2248330398452538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
Mouse Gestures is a new operating mode different from shortcuts and menu operation. It refers to the use of the mouse to draw the graph and identification to complete the operation. As an efficient, innovative, convenient features, Mouse gestures is welcomed and widely used in browser. However, the application of the current mouse gesture is limited to internet browsers, and only use straight line, polyline and other simple gestures, research and application of complex mouse gestures is still relatively few.As mouse gesture recognition algorithm, BP artificial neural network is the one of the most studied. Artificial neural network is a nonlinear algorithm based on biological information processing neural network with adaptive learning, parallel processing features, and distributed information storage capacity. BP back-propagation neural network is currently the most widely used artificial neural network. BP back-propagation neural network is a multilayer feed-forward networks trained using back-propagation algorithm. BP network technology is mature, simple structure, and has been widely used in pattern recognition, function approximation and other fields.However, the standard BP neural network exist many shortcomings, for example, trapped in local minima, low learning efficiency, slow convergence etc. For overcoming these shortcomings, researchers have proposed additional momentum, adaptive learning rate, conjugate gradient method, and many improved BP neural network algorithm to improve the convergence speed and reduce errors. However, the improved neural network algorithm has not been applied to the mouse gesture recognition software.This paper studies the neural network algorithm in mouse gestures application. The paper use Matlab to simulate BP neural network improved algorithm, and then analysis the results and try to find a kind of neural network algorithm that fitting for mouse gesture recognition. As different structures of network having different capability for mouse gesture recognition, BP back-propagation neural networks with different layers, different number of neurons in the hidden layer and different transfer functions were simulated and analysis based on to mouse gesture recognition data, look for right network structure for the mouse gesture recognition. Then, based on the simulation conclusion, the paper implement a complex mouse gesture recognition software.The result shows, the mouse gesture recognition software using the network structure and improved algorithm that find out by simulation is practical, run fast,and have high recognition rate. It is considered to be a good PC desktop application tools for complex mouse gestures recognition.
Keywords/Search Tags:mouse gesture, BP neural network algorithm, Artificial NeuralNetworks
PDF Full Text Request
Related items